On 9, 2020, the Federal Reserve released an updated term sheet for the Term Asset-Backed Securities Loan Facility (“TALF”) april. Eligible borrowers under TALF (“Eligible Borrowers”) must now be U.S. businesses that have qualified security and continue maintaining a merchant account relationship with a primary dealer. A “U.S. company” now could be understood to be a company that is developed or organized in america or beneath the legislation associated with the united states of america and that has significant operations, and a lot of its employees, situated in america.

Also, the updated term sheet expanded the classes of eligible collateral to add fixed collateralized loan obligations (“CLO”)( that is, handled CLOs with reinvestment features aren’t qualified security), and legacy commercial mortgage-backed securities (“CMBS”) released just before March 23, 2020. Qualified CMBS should be pertaining to genuine home found in america or one of its regions. By limiting eligible CLO collateral to static CLOs and limiting qualified CMBS collateral to legacy CMBS, the Federal Reserve would not get because far with those two asset types as much were hoping.

The Federal Reserve also noted so it may start thinking about including asset that is new as eligible collateral as time goes by, and published a haircut routine utilizing the updated term sheet that described the assets that will count as eligible collateral at lower than 100percent regarding the worth associated with asset, which routine is in line with the haircut routine employed for the TALF created in 2008.

The Federal Reserve additionally published updated prices terms. The attention price for CLOs should be 150 foundation points throughout the 30-day average guaranteed instantly funding price (“SOFR”). The Federal Reserve appears to be endorsing SOFR as the replacement rate for LIBOR by referencing SOFR. For SBA Pool Certificates (7(a) loans), the attention price would be the the surface of the federal funds target range plus 75 foundation points. For SBA developing Company Participation Certificates (504 loans), the attention price are going to be 75 basis points within the fed that is 3-year instantly index swap (“OIS”) price.

For many other qualified asset-backed securities with underlying credit exposures which do not have a federal government guarantee, the attention price would be 125 foundation points on the 2-year OIS price for securities by having a weighted average life lower than 2 yrs, or 125 foundation points throughout the 3-year OIS rate for securities by having a weighted typical life of couple of years or greater.

There are several problems that are notable the Federal Reserve will have to fix within an updated TALF term sheet

  • First, the alteration into the “Eligible Borrower” definition – particularly the alteration into the meaning of “U.S. company” – will likely allow it to be burdensome for numerous issuers to work well with the TALF and certainly will probably exclude countless investment funds.
  • 2nd, the updated term sheet deleted servicing that is“eligible receivables” from the eligible collateral definition. At this time it really is confusing whether qualified servicing advance receivables should be entitled to relief under a program that is separate.
  • Third, it really is not clear just exactly what the Federal Reserve means by “newly released” whenever referring to underlying credit exposures. But not clearly stated, it will be possible that this implies securities that are asset-backed on or after March 23, 2020.

Industry sources believe qualified security would be expanded to add non-agency domestic mortgage-backed securities and installment that is personal. In addition they remember that it really is not likely the Federal Reserve will expand eligible collateral beyond AAA-rated securities that are car title loans asset-backed. Industry sources note that is further credit risk transfer (“CRT”) bonds are not likely getting any rest from the Federal Reserve because of the requirement that eligible security be AAA-rated. Further, it isn’t clear that the Federal Housing Finance management is dedicated to saving the CRT relationship market.
